This morning's river flows in cubic feet per second for 
Tuesday, March 15, 2005. Please note that all data are provisional.

-Colorado Basin-                       -Green River Basin-

Colorado nr Kremmling            420  Green blo Fontenelle         e1200
Crystal nr Redstone               70  Green blo Flaming Gorge       1000
Colorado at Westwater           3200  Yampa at Maybell               720
Gunnison blo Gunnison Tun        840  Little Snake nr Lily           600
Dolores blo Mcphee                30  Green at Jensen               2100
Dolores nr Bedrock               270  White nr Watson               e390
Dolores nr Cisco                 840  Green nr Green R, Ut          3500
Colorado nr Cisco               4100  San Rafael nr Green R, Ut       15
Cataract Canyon                e7400  Escalante nr Escalante          10
Lake Powell Inflow             e8400  Cottonwood Ck blo Joes Val      10
Virgin nr Virgin                 540  Muddy nr Emery                   5
Virgin nr Littlefield            460  Dirty Devil near Hanksvill     160
Colorado at Lees Ferry          6600  

-Great Basin-                         -San Juan Basin-

Weber nr Oakley                   75  San Juan nr Archuleta          350
Weber nr Echo                 near 0  Animas nr Durango              780
Weber at Gateway                 240  San Juan nr Bluff             1750
Ogden blo Pineview Dam            20
Provo nr Woodland                 55
Provo blo Deer Ck Dam             85  
Sevier blo Piute Dam             200

-Salt Basin-

Salt nr Chyrsotile             e2100

Trend for the next 2 days: Fluctuating near present levels.
                  
Forecast flows in cubic feet per second for Tuesday thru Thursday:

Colorado - Westwater........ 3000-3600
Colorado - nr Cisco......... 3400-4200
San Juan - nr Bluff......... 1500-1800
Green - nr Green River, Ut.. 3200-3700
Cataract Canyon............. 6800-7800
Salt nr Chrysotile.......... 1600-2150
